Why sleep feels harder than it should

When sleep gets difficult, it’s often less about “willpower” and more about the conditions your nervous system is dealing with at night.

  • Arousal overload: Bright light, loud content, caffeine timing, and late-day stress keep the body in “on” mode.
  • Unstructured evenings: Without a consistent cue, the brain treats bedtime as negotiable and keeps problem-solving.
  • Conditioned wakefulness: Repeated tossing and turning teaches the bed to feel like a thinking zone, not a sleeping zone.
  • Timing mismatch: Going to bed before genuine sleepiness can increase frustration and clock-watching.
  • Small environment leaks: Heat, noise, and light that seem minor can add up to frequent micro-awakenings.

How to use the checklist for calmer nights

  • Pick a realistic target bedtime and protect the last 30–60 minutes as a wind-down window.
  • Start with the “minimum viable routine” on hectic nights (3–5 steps) to keep consistency without pressure.
  • Use the checklist in the same order each night so the sequence becomes a cue, not a menu.
  • If sleep doesn’t arrive after about 20 minutes, do a quiet reset activity in low light until sleepy (then return to bed).
  • Keep wake time steady most days; a consistent morning anchor helps the next night’s sleep pressure build naturally.
  • Track only what matters: note the few steps that most strongly predict faster sleep (for many people: light, temperature, and screens).

FAQ

How quickly can a bedtime checklist help improve sleep?

Some people notice a faster wind-down within a few nights, but more consistent sleep timing and fewer awakenings often take 1–3 weeks of repetition. The biggest gains usually come from doing a small routine consistently rather than chasing a perfect routine.

What if I follow the routine but still can’t fall asleep?

If you’re awake for about 20 minutes, do a quiet, low-light reset activity until you feel drowsy, then return to bed. Avoid clock-watching and anything stimulating, and double-check common disruptors like caffeine timing, stress load, and room temperature.

Is an AI-guided checklist a replacement for medical advice?

No—an AI-guided checklist can support healthy routines, but it doesn’t diagnose or treat sleep disorders. If insomnia persists, loud snoring comes with daytime sleepiness, or symptoms affect safety and daily function, seek professional evaluation.
